Gildan Activewear Inc
Gildan Activewear Inc. (Gildan) is a marketer and vertically-integrated global manufacturer of basic, non-fashion apparel products for customers. It sells active wear products to screen print markets in North America, Europe and other international markets. Gildan is a supplier of active wear for the screen print channel in the United States and Canada, and also a supplier for this market in Europe and Mexico. It sells socks and underwear, in addition to its active wear products, to mass market and regional retailers in North America. In the United States mass market retail channel, Gildan is a supplier of socks. The Company operates in one business segment non-fashion apparel. On March 31, 2010, the Company completed the acquisition of Shahriyar Fabric Industries Limited (Shahriyar), vertically-integrated knitting, dyeing, finishing, cutting and sewing facility for the manufacture of ring-spun T-shirts near in Bangladesh. On May 9, 2012, the Company acquired Anvil Holdings, Inc.
